Summerfest celebrates the beginning of summer with diverse arts, great food, live musical performances and much more. The festival takes place along Virginia Avenue, in the heart of historic Virginia-Highland.
Recently voted the “Best Neighborhood Festival” in Creative Loafing and consistently revered by art professionals as one of the best artists’ markets in the southeast, Summerfest is a great event for the entire family.
